Business news is a type of financial or economical news that covers events and issues that are of interest to businesses. This type of news is often published in newspapers and magazines, both online and in print. Some of these publications are broad in scope and cover business-related issues that effect the general population, while others are more specific and focus on certain industries. Business-related news is also frequently found in trade publications, which are intended for members of a particular industry.

Generally, business news focuses on the actions and policies of companies, as well as the markets in which they operate. It can cover topics such as the performance of specific stocks, the success of a particular company, or the state of the economy. In addition, business news can be about the latest technological advancements in the field of business, as well as the latest business trends.

The purpose of a business is to provide goods or services in exchange for money. Companies often seek to make profits on these transactions in order to grow their enterprises and create jobs. In some cases, they may also seek to aid economic growth and contribute to the welfare of society. However, the nature of business varies from one industry to the next, and it can be difficult to identify common characteristics.

Companies can be structured in a variety of ways, depending on their size and location. For example, some small businesses are run by sole proprietors and others are organized as limited liability corporations. Some large companies are owned by shareholders and are publicly traded on the stock market, while others are privately held or operated by a family. A business can also be classified by its industry, such as the real estate business or mattress production business.
